Hi guys,

i have a tomtom one v3 (see below the information) and it always worked fine with Navcore 8562.
But now I wanted to upgrade my map to 915 or 920 but I see that a lot of maps are only supported with navcore 9.xxx (if you want ALG).
So I started to install a new navcore 9.485 with memory boost (from downunder).
It all installs well and seems to work well. I enter a route and it calculates the fastest route and it starts. Seems to work fine.
But then when it tries to do a re-calculation of the route my tomtom just hangs and after a few seconds it reboots.
So only after a recalculation it gives problems.

Does anyone know what I can do to fix this? Of should I just pick another navcore? (recommendations?)

I have to add that I'm using an 8GB DSHC card.

maestro30 wrote:I've read something about the reskin file but honestly I don't know what to change if I want another skin (X40?).


Open the file "reskin" on the folder "skins" with Notepad++
Edit the first entry so it shows the emulation you want to use.
It'll will make more sense once you see it.

EDIT:
think I found it!
I have changed the skin file and now I have: DSA emulation mode=24-GOx40;25;25-GO
So the first entry is the first value left from the first ';' sign. That value can be changed by one of the others.
Just sharing for those who also couldn't find out (or maybe I'm the only one :-) )
